Job description

Overview

3T Additive Manufacturing Ltd invites you to join our expanding engineering team at the forefront of additive manufacturing (3D printing), servicing the Aerospace, Defence, Space, Energy, and Industrial sectors. This role is based at Greenham Business Park, Thatcham RG19 6HN. Working hours: Monday to Friday 08:30–16:30 (earlier finish on Fridays).

The Opportunity

We’re looking for an experienced and hands-on Manufacturing Engineer to play a pivotal role in delivering customer projects from NPI right through to final delivery. You’ll be at the heart of optimising and monitoring our manufacturing processes, ensuring every project runs with maximum efficiency, quality and safety.

With your technical expertise and customer focus, you’ll drive continuous improvement initiatives, define manufacturing and equipment requirements, and ensure our processes are always a step ahead.

Responsibilities
  • Determine the most effective and economical methods of manufacture
  • Advise on project implementation and manufacturing requirements
  • Identify and implement improvements to manufacturing processes
  • Resolve production and quality issues swiftly and effectively
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to meet customer expectations
Qualifications
  • Proven experience as a Manufacturing/Project/Process Engineer
  • Skilled in working with raw metal materials/metal machining processes from design through to manufacture
  • Strong understanding of manufacturing processes and optimisation techniques
  • Confident in customer interaction and translating requirements into practical solutions
  • Ability to work collaboratively across departments to deliver projects on time and to spec
  • Essential - right to work in the UK without Visa Sponsorship now or in the future
